Django Web開發 2 Django入門

2022-05-20 22:04:34 字數 1438 閱讀 8136

配置開發環境

1.安裝python,我使用的是centos 6.0,python版本為2.6.6

2.安裝django,django版本為1.3.5

python setup.py install

可以通過以下命令檢查是否正確安裝了django。

django-admin.py --version

如果結果輸出了django的版本,則安裝成功。

3.安裝資料庫,這裡使用mysql,請自行安裝。

在linux終端輸入以下命令,建立django_bookmarks專案。

$ django-admin.py startproject django_bookmarks

這個命令會在當前目錄中建立乙個名為django_bookmarks的資料夾,資料夾中的結構如下:

django_bookmarks/__init__.py

manage.py

settings.py

urls.py

__init__.py說明這個資料夾是python包,manage.py用來對整個工程進行管理,它的作用與django-admin.py差不多。settings.py是整個專案的配置檔案,url.py用來對url的分發進行配置。

資料庫配置

開啟settings.py中,對資料進行配置,settings.py中關於資料配置的選項如下:

database_engine = 'mysql

'database_name = '

bookmarksdb

'database_user = 'root'

database_password = ''

database_host = 'localhost'

database_port = '3306'

這裡由於我們使用mysql資料庫,因此database_engine的值設為mysql,而我們的資料庫名字令它為bookmarksdb,mysql預設埠為3306。修改完上面的配置之後,執行下面的**進行資料庫初始化。

python manage.py syncdb

執行上面的**,django會自動建立相應的資料表。

啟動伺服器

django自身提供了乙個伺服器,用於開發環境的測試。這個伺服器有個好處就是,每當**修改之後,它都會自動重啟。

使用下面的命令啟動伺服器:

$ python manage.py runserver

然後開啟瀏覽器,輸入

$ python manage.py runserver

$ python manage.py runserver 0.0.0.0:9000

上面的伺服器監聽所有ip位址的9000埠。

Django Web開發總結

即將分享總結。一 django的安裝 sudo apt get install python djangodjango安裝成功之後,可以使用django admin命令進行web的開發,django admin常用的命令有 startproject projectname 建立新的django專案 ...

Django Web開發指南

國內第一本django圖書 django web開發指南 歡迎使用django 歡迎來到django的世界,很高興能和你一起進行這趟旅程。你會發現有了這個強大的web框架,做每件事情都變得便捷起來 從設計開發新應用到不用大刀闊斧地修改 就能為現有 提供新的特性和功能。關於本書 市面上已經有了一些講解...

django web開發框架簡介 01

核心思想 高可擴充套件性 向後相容 低耦合,高內聚 pip freeze可匯出安裝包 虛擬環境安裝 sudo apt install python virtualenv建立虛擬環境 virtualenv 虛擬環境名稱 linux上通過virtualenv部署虛擬環境 linux下的虛擬環境使用 pi...